#062ba2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#062ba2 is composed of 2.4% red, 16.9% green and 63.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 96.3% cyan, 73.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 36.5% black. It has a hue angle of 225.8 degrees, a saturation of 92.9% and a lightness of 32.9%. #062ba2 color hex could be obtained by blending #0c56ff with #000045. Closest websafe color is: #003399.

Shades and Tints of #062ba2
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#00030b is the darkest color, while #f7f9ff is the lightest one.
